If the seat belts are not worn or are worn incorrectly, the risk of severe or fatal injuries increases. Seat belts can only provide optimal protection if the seat belt routing is correct. Assuming an incorrect sitting position considerably impairs the level of protection provided by a seat belt. This could lead to severe or even fatal injuries. The risk of severe or fatal injuries is especially increased when a triggering airbag strikes an occupant who has assumed an incorrect sitting position. The driver is responsible for all vehicle passengers, especially if they are children.
